The property is a four bedroom detached house dating from the 1930s which has been sympathetically extended and retains much of its original character. The accommodation consists of a spacious dining room, lounge, kitchen/breakfast room, study, downstairs WC. To the first floor there are four generous bedrooms with a good size en-suite to the maser bedroom and a large family bathroom.
A feature of this property is the secluded west facing rear garden extending to approximately 115ft with a patio area with the remainder laid to lawn and an outdoor studio, a versatile space currently being used as an office as it has power and lighting. There is additional storage area to the side. To the front there is a good size driveway providing off street parking for up to four vehicles and a garage.
